A distinctive Viognier, and easily one of the state’s best. Has the usual array of stone and tropical fruit flavors, with a minerality that’s refreshing. Crisp and authoritative, sleek and refined, and perfectly oaked. Stunning, with the richness of a fine Chardonnay.

Tags:
wine ratingwine ratingwine ratingwine ratingwine rating
Andrew Murray Viognier - 2001

For all its obvious power, this wine is elegant and stylish. The sweet cherry fruit is wrapped in a layer of lavender, thyme and sweet oak. The flavors coat the mouth and last for a long time. The underlying strength and staying power of this wine shows in the tannic finish. Best after 2007.

Tags:
wine ratingwine ratingwine ratingwine ratingwine rating
Andrew Murray Syrah - 2001

A Rhone blend of Viognier, Marsanne, and Rousanne, it offers a myriad of fruity, flowery aromas and complex flavors ranging from banana to chocolate cream to melon. The smooth, velvety texture carries sweetly ripe fruit in waves across the palate.

Tags:
wine ratingwine ratingwine ratingwine ratingwine rating
Andrew Murray White Blend - 2000
